First United Methodist Church of Cedar Hill

Marker installed: 1976

The first church occupied by this congregation was destroyed by a tornado in 1856, two years after the fellowship was organized. A frame building was erected in 1883 on a lot adjacent to this site. It was replaced in 1900 by this structure. Typical of many churches that once dominated the countryside, this edifice has an off-center entry tower and Gothic detailing. The bell placed here in 1900 still summons worshipers.
